15. Calculate the coefficient of separation of copper and magnesium during their extraction with a solution of 8-hydroxyquinoline in chloroform, if the initial concentrations of metals and phase volumes are equal, and the extraction degrees are 97.0 and 23.0%, respectively.
Answer: α = 108.
